Overview of the Ophthalmic System, barrier in the eye. The limited external surface area and the deep isolated location of the different structures of the eye along with avascularity of some of the structures and the blood–retina barrier pose unique challenges for delivery of drugs to intraocular structures.作者: CUR 時(shí)間: 2025-3-24 00:29

Overview of the Ophthalmic System,prised of unique structures with distinct structure and functions that work together for the perception of sight. Structures like the cornea, the crystalline lens, and the vitreous humor are avascular structures, while the uveal tract is primarily the vascular layer of the eye. Ocular Preservatives: Risks and Recent Trends in Its Application in Ocular Drug Delivery (ODD),on and low cost. Preservatives are the most important ingredients in ocular formulations next to active ingredient. These are often included to prevent the chances of inadvertent contamination of the ocular formulations preserved in multidose containers, most frequently during opening and applicatio作者: 赦免 時(shí)間: 2025-3-30 14:55 作者: 做作 時(shí)間: 2025-3-30 17:28 作者: 加花粗鄙人 時(shí)間: 2025-3-30 23:04
